Realme X7 Max 5G Device Overview:
The Realme X7 Max features a 6.43-inch Super AMOLED panel with a resolution of 1080 x 2400 pixels and an aspect ratio of 20:9. It is a high refresh rate panel with a 120Hz refresh rate. It also has a peak brightness of 1000 nits. Under the hood, we have the MediaTek Dimensity 1200 5G built on a 6nm manufacturing process. It is an octa-core processor with one Cortex-A78 core clocked at 3.0 GHz, three Cortex-A78 cores clocked at 2.6 GHz, and four Cortex-A55 cores clocked at 2.0 GHz. We have the Mali-G77 MC9 as the GPU for the smartphone.
